De Gea set to join PSG if contract talks with Manchester United fails

By Promise Amadi

Manchester United Goalkeeper David de Gea may join France Ligue 1 champions, PSG during the summer transfer window.

Okay Nigeria understands that the Spanish goalkeeper wants a weekly wage of £350,000 which is yet be agreed by both parties.

De Gea’s contract with Manchester United will expire by the year 2020 and Paris Saint-Germain is willing to meet his demands.

The France Ligue 1 champions are looking for a new keeper with 40-year-old Gianluigi Buffon coming to the end of his career.

De Gea joined Manchester United from Atletico Madrid for £22.5million in 2011.

He has played 353 times for the club, winning the Premier League in 2013, along with an FA Cup, League Cup, and Europa League.
